WebTSH is a hormone produced by the pituitary gland in the brain that tells the thyroid gland how much thyroid hormone to make. When thyroid hormone levels are low, TSH levels increase, and when thyroid hormone levels are high, TSH levels decrease. A normal TSH level typically falls within the range of 0.4-4.0 mIU/L. WebA high TSH and low FT4 and FT3 indicate hypothyroidism. A normal TSH, normal FT4, and low FT3 can indicate T4 to T3 conversion problems, and a normal or high TSH, normal FT4 and high FT3 can indicate cellular resistance to FT3 which can still lead to hypothyroid symptoms because the active hormone can’t get to the cell to do its job.
